jiucaionly 发表于 2021-7-9 14:54

易语言post 求助

本帖最后由 jiucaionly 于 2021-7-9 19:38 编辑

post   抓包时的表单数据怎么写?
recordId: 21172022
position: 480
timeOutConfirm: false

点击查看源后
------WebKitFormBoundaryjBMJ1LjBqTKGhmgq
Content-Disposition: form-data; name="recordId"

21172022
------WebKitFormBoundaryjBMJ1LjBqTKGhmgq
Content-Disposition: form-data; name="position"

480
------WebKitFormBoundaryjBMJ1LjBqTKGhmgq
Content-Disposition: form-data; name="timeOutConfirm"

false
------WebKitFormBoundaryjBMJ1LjBqTKGhmgq--

阿汤 发表于 2021-7-9 15:04

表单数据POST提交,文件数据转换为字节集提交

jiucaionly 发表于 2021-7-9 15:15

阿汤 发表于 2021-7-9 15:04
表单数据POST提交,文件数据转换为字节集提交
求指导下啊大佬
这个怎么转换啊

------WebKitFormBoundaryjBMJ1LjBqTKGhmgq
Content-Disposition: form-data; name="recordId"

21172022
------WebKitFormBoundaryjBMJ1LjBqTKGhmgq
Content-Disposition: form-data; name="position"

480
------WebKitFormBoundaryjBMJ1LjBqTKGhmgq
Content-Disposition: form-data; name="timeOutConfirm"

false
------WebKitFormBoundaryjBMJ1LjBqTKGhmgq--

IBinary 发表于 2021-7-9 15:38

兄弟上python呀. 都是抓包爬虫. 还能学习python这门语言.

jiucaionly 发表于 2021-7-9 15:42

何故 发表于 2021-7-9 15:24
提交参数="recordId=21172022&position=480&timeOutConfirm=false"

大佬,发包无反应啊

jiucaionly 发表于 2021-7-9 15:44

IBinary 发表于 2021-7-9 15:38
兄弟上python呀. 都是抓包爬虫. 还能学习python这门语言.

想学习下易语言{:1_918:}

jiucaionly 发表于 2021-7-9 16:32

何故 发表于 2021-7-9 16:28
有反应的{"message":"无效的参数","extraData":null,"hr":-2147463167,"data":null}

我运行无任何反应啊你修改哪里了吗?

kll545012 发表于 2021-7-9 17:10

网页_访问_对象()里面有个参数是,字节集提交,这种方式要用字节集提交

阿仁同学 发表于 2021-7-9 17:19

添加协议头就好了

hbqjb 发表于 2021-7-9 17:30

举例,举实例,如下:

首先,在“常量表”中建立三个常量:url、数据、协议头。

“url”常量值为https://degree.qingshuxuetang.com

“数据”值为
------WebKitFormBoundaryjBMJ1LjBqTKGhmgq
Content-Disposition: form-data; name="recordId"

21172022
------WebKitFormBoundaryjBMJ1LjBqTKGhmgq
Content-Disposition: form-data; name="position"

480
------WebKitFormBoundaryjBMJ1LjBqTKGhmgq
Content-Disposition: form-data; name="timeOutConfirm"

false
......


“协议头”的值为
Accept:......
Accept-Encoding:......
Accept-Lanquage:......
Connection:......
Content-Length:......
Content-Type:......
Cookie:......
Host:......
Origin:......
Referer......
.
.
.
User-Agent:......
X-Requested-With:......

然后,在程序集中设个文本型的变量str,然后,写两句代码:
cookie = “AccessToken........product”
str = 编码_Utf8到Ansi (网页_访问_对象 (#url, 1, #数据, cookie, , #协议头, , , ))

就OK了!
页: [1] 2
查看完整版本: 易语言post 求助